قدّم وتابع مع أبلاي إيدجLocation: Delhi, in-officeType: Full time (6 day work week with 1 day work from home)About RxMenRxMen is a men's health platform. Men in India avoid getting treated for the things that bother them most, so we built a private, structured way to get real care, across sexual health, sleep and more. We are early, we move fast, and almost every decision here is settled by pulling the numbers.This is a 6 day work week role based out of our Delhi office, with 1 day of work from home.You should apply if you have:3+ years of experience as a Data Analyst, Business Analyst, or in a similar analytics role.Strong SQL skills with the ability to write complex analytical queries involving multiple tables, CTEs, window functions, and performance optimization.Hands on experience pulling data from third party APIs, for example ad platforms, payment gateways or CRM tools, and turning that into usable datasets without engineering support.Hands-on experience building business dashboards using BI tools such as Metabase, Tableau, Looker or Power BI.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to convert business questions into structured analyses.Experience working with large datasets and translating data into meaningful business insights.Excellent communication skills and confidence in presenting insights to senior stakeholders.The ability to independently manage ambiguous requests while balancing multiple priorities.An AI-first mindset and comfort using AI tools to improve analytical workflows and productivity.You should not apply if you:Prefer repetitive reporting over solving complex business problems.Are uncomfortable working with SQL, dashboards, and large datasets.Need constant direction and struggle to independently navigate ambiguous requirements.Avoid interacting with stakeholders or translating business needs into analytical solutions.See analytics as just generating reports rather than influencing business decisions.Are resistant to feedback, learning new tools, or leveraging AI to improve your productivity.Prefer maintaining the status quo instead of building scalable, automated reporting solutions.Are uncomfortable taking ownership in a fast-paced, high-growth environment where priorities evolve quickly.Don't enjoy collaborating across functions or communicating insights to non-technical stakeholders.Are looking for a role with limited responsibility rather than one that requires ownership, curiosity, and continuous improvement.Skills Required:Technical SkillsAdvanced SQL (joins, CTEs, window functions, query optimization, aggregations)Data analysis and business analyticsDashboard developmentData visualization and storytellingMicrosoft Excel / Google Sheets (advanced)Python for data analysis and automationUnderstanding of relational databases and data warehousing conceptsBusiness & Analytical SkillsStrong problem-solving and critical thinkingAbility to translate ambiguous business questions into structured analysesKPI definition, tracking, and performance reportingRoot-cause analysis and hypothesis-driven problem solvingBusiness acumen across Product, Marketing, Operations, SalesExperience working with Healthtech, D2C, E-commerce, Retail, or Consumer business metricsWhat will you do?Own the end-to-end lifecycle of business data requests; dashboards, reports, and ad hoc analyses, while meeting defined SLAs.Build and maintain scalable dashboardsConvert recurring manual requests into automated, self-service reporting solutions.Translate complex business questions into clear, actionable insights.Work closely with stakeholders across Product, Brand, Marketing, Operations, SalesEnsure reporting accuracy, consistency, and data quality across business functions.Support strategic business decisions through data storytelling and meaningful visualizations.What success looks likeDuring your first three months, you'll:Bring analytics BAU under control, with a median turnaround time of two days or less.Improve SLA adherence across stakeholder requests.Convert recurring business requests into reusable self-service dashboards.Improve dashboard reliability and minimize reporting disruptions.
